Charles Kenneth Kulas Obituary

We are sad to announce that on May 10, 2019 we had to say goodbye to Charles Kenneth Kulas (Minneapolis, Minnesota), born in Winona, Minnesota. Leave a sympathy message to the family in the guestbook on this memorial page of Charles Kenneth Kulas to show support.

He was predeceased by: his parents, Charles Kulas and Eleanor Kulas; and his sister Sharon. He is survived by: his former wife Stephanie Knopick; his sister Mary Lou Hazelton (Roy); his nephew Chris Hazelton (Jennifer); and his niece Holly Lecheler (Dan).

In lieu of flowers, memorials preferred to Pancreatic Cancer Action Network and/or Twin's Community Fund.
